Natural Born Survivor is Michael D. Anderson’s heart-wrenching autobiographical account of a young boy surviving the brutal ghetto streets of Cleveland to become a powerful man of purpose. Homelessness, touring with R&B Superstars Jodeci, becoming one of Cleveland’s biggest drug dealers and facing 17 – 50 years in prison, Natural Born Survivor will take you on a roller-coaster ride of emotions as you root for the boy and cheer for the man.
